1 definition found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Incompliance \In`com*pli"ance\, n. 1. The quality or state of being incompliant; unyielding temper; obstinacy. [1913 Webster] Self-conceit produces peevishness and incompliance of humor in things lawful and indifferent. --Tillotson. [1913 Webster] 2. Refusal or failure to comply. --Strype. [1913 Webster]
